The show revolves around the Blackadder family, with each season set in a different historical era, from the Middle Ages to the Elizabethan era. The main character, Edmund Blackadder, is a cunning and intelligent nobleman who often finds himself in absurd situations, while his family members and servants provide comedic relief.
